What's Happening?
British personal care brand Wild has announced Emma Raducanu as its first global ambassador. Raducanu, a British tennis player currently competing in the U.S. Open, will lead Wild's 'Champions of Change' campaign, which focuses on performance and eco-responsibility. Raducanu expressed her commitment to using her platform to make a difference, aligning with Wild's sustainability and innovation goals. As part of the partnership, Raducanu will promote Wild's refillable deodorant, priced at $16, with refills at $7.20. She will also feature in a TV commercial set to air in the U.K. in 2026. Wild, founded in 2019, has gained prominence in sustainable beauty, with Unilever acquiring the brand earlier this year. The brand's products are available at major retailers in the U.K. and the U.S.
Why It's Important?
This partnership highlights the growing trend of athletes using their influence to promote sustainability and eco-friendly practices. Raducanu's involvement with Wild could enhance the brand's visibility and appeal, particularly among younger consumers who prioritize environmental responsibility. The collaboration also underscores the importance of sustainable practices in the beauty industry, which is increasingly under scrutiny for its environmental impact. Wild's acquisition by Unilever and its expansion into the U.S. market reflect the brand's potential for growth and influence in promoting sustainable personal care products.
